IEEE 81-2012 is a technical guide for measuring earth resistivity, ground impedance, and earth surface potentials of a grounding system. It is relevant to power, energy, and industrial applications where grounding performance affects safety and electrical reliability. By outlining measurement methods for soil and grounding-system behavior, the standard helps engineers obtain consistent data for design review, troubleshooting, and verification work. For projects involving substations, plant grounding, or similar installations, IEEE 81-2012 supports more informed engineering decisions.

About IEEE 81-2012

This standard focuses on practical methods used to evaluate how a grounding system interacts with the earth and surrounding surface potentials. IEEE 81-2012 is commonly consulted when engineers need to measure earth resistivity before grounding design, assess ground impedance after installation, or review surface potential conditions around a site. Its guidance is useful in technical environments where grounding data must be collected in a repeatable way and interpreted with care. The document is especially valuable when measurement results influence system design or safety assessments.

Where is IEEE 81-2012 used?

IEEE 81-2012 is typically used in electrical utility work, industrial power facilities, and engineering studies for grounding and earthing systems. It is relevant to substations, generation sites, switchyards, and large equipment installations where earth resistivity and ground impedance measurements help confirm performance. The standard may also support commissioning, troubleshooting, and site investigations involving test instruments, grounding grids, and surface potential measurements. In these settings, IEEE 81-2012 provides a common technical basis for field measurements and reporting.
